Ingredients You’ll Need
These are simple, wholesome ingredients that you’ll love working with for this Pineapple Chicken and Rice dish. Each one contributes to the wonderful flavors that make this meal so special:
For the Chicken
- 1 lb chicken breast, diced
- 1 tbsp olive oil
For the Rice Mixture
- 1 can (20 oz) pineapple chunks, drained (reserve juice)
- 1 cup jasmine or basmati rice, uncooked
- 1 1/2 cups chicken broth
- 1/4 cup soy sauce
- 2 tbsp honey
- 1 clove garlic, minced
- 1 tsp ginger, grated or ground
- 1 red bell pepper, chopped
- 1/4 cup green onions, sliced
- Salt and pepper, to taste
- Fresh cilantro, for garnish

How to Make Pineapple Chicken and Rice
Step 1: Cook the Chicken
Start by heating ol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add your diced chicken and cook until it’s beautifully browned and fully cooked—about 6-7 minutes should do it! Removing the chicken from the skillet allows you to build those lovely flavors in the next steps without overcrowding the pan.
Step 2: Sauté Aromatics
In the same skillet, toss in minced garlic, grated ginger, and chopped bell pepper. Sauté them for about 2-3 minutes until they’re fragrant. This step not only enhances their natural sweetness but also creates an aromatic base that will elevate your dish.
Step 3: Combine Ingredients
Next, stir in your uncooked rice along with chicken broth, reserved pineapple juice, soy sauce, and honey. Mixing everything together ensures that every grain of rice gets coated in that delicious flavor while absorbing all those tasty liquids as it cooks!
Step 4: Simmer Away
Bring your mixture to a boil before reducing the heat to low. Cover your skillet and let it simmer for 15-18 minutes. This gentle cooking allows the rice to become tender while soaking up all those savory juices—a crucial step for achieving perfect texture!
Step 5: Add Chicken and Pineapple
After simmering, gently stir in your cooked chicken and drained pineapple chunks. Let everything heat through for an additional 2-3 minutes. The warmth brings out even more sweetness from the pineapple—trust me; it’s worth it!
Step 6: Final Touches
Garnish with fresh cilantro and sliced green onions before seasoning with salt and pepper to taste. Serve this vibrant dish hot and watch as everyone gathers around excitedly! Enjoy every last bite of your Pineapple Chicken and Rice!
Pro Tips for Making Pineapple Chicken and Rice
Creating the perfect Pineapple Chicken and Rice is all about those little details that elevate your dish. Here are some tried-and-true tips to ensure your meal turns out delicious every time!
- Use fresh pineapple: Fresh pineapple adds a vibrant flavor and texture that canned varieties can’t match. If using fresh, be sure to cut it into bite-sized pieces for even cooking.
- Marinate the chicken: For added depth of flavor, consider marinating the diced chicken in soy sauce, ginger, and garlic for 30 minutes before cooking. This step enhances the umami taste and ensures juicy chicken.
- Adjust sweetness: Depending on your taste preferences, you can increase or decrease the amount of honey used in the recipe. This flexibility allows you to create a dish that suits your palate perfectly.
- Cook rice separately: If you’re looking for a fluffier texture, you might want to cook the rice separately and then mix it with the chicken and pineapple just before serving. This helps prevent overcooking and keeps each grain distinct.

Make Ahead and Storage
Pineapple Chicken and Rice is an excellent option for meal prep, making it easy to enjoy delicious, home-cooked meals throughout the week. With just a few simple storage tips, you can keep this dish fresh and ready to go.
Storing Leftovers
- Allow the dish to cool completely before storing.
- Transfer leftovers to an airtight container.
- Store in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days.
Freezing
- Let the dish cool completely before freezing.
- Portion out servings into freezer-safe containers.
- Seal tightly and freeze for up to 2-3 months.
Reheating
- Thaw overnight in the refrigerator if frozen.
- Reheat in a microwave-safe dish, stirring occasionally until heated through.
- Alternatively, reheat on the stovetop over medium heat, adding a splash of chicken broth if needed to prevent sticking.
FAQs
Here are some common questions about Pineapple Chicken and Rice that may help you out!
Can I use brown rice instead of jasmine or basmati rice for Pineapple Chicken and Rice?
Yes! Brown rice is a nutritious alternative, but keep in mind that it will require a longer cooking time—about 25-30 minutes. Adjust your liquid accordingly to ensure it cooks properly.
What can I substitute for chicken in Pineapple Chicken and Rice?
You can easily substitute chicken with tofu or tempeh for a vegetarian version. Just make sure to adjust cooking times as necessary for your chosen protein source.
Is Pineapple Chicken and Rice good for meal prep?
Absolutely! This dish stores well in the fridge or freezer and makes for a quick reheat meal during busy weekdays.
